Meadowlands: Nelsonbriteagle flies to victory in her FanDuel Championship

Jay Bergman|Nov 30, 2024
Nelsonbriteagle No 11-30-24
Lisa Photo Nelsonbriteagle became the newest sub-1:50 trotter out of the Ake Svanstedt barn on Saturday at the Meadowlands

Norwegian-bred Nelsonbriteagle and driver Dexter Dunn took control before the quarter and cruised to a record victory in capturing the $150,000 FanDuel Championship final for filly and mare trotters at the Meadowlands on Saturday night. The Ake Svanstedt-trained daughter of Bold Eagle set a stakes- and personal-best with her 1:49 4/5 mile.

The short field of six saw half the horses leave, but Allegiant and Scott Zeron were first to the front, putting M-M's Dream in the pocket. R Melina, one of two sophomores in the field, broke stride and took herself out before the first turn. Dunn had Nelsonbriteagle energized and took control before the 27 2/5 quarter had been passed. Once on the point Dunn just kept the fractions honest, hitting the half in 55 seconds before Svanstedt, with stablemate Call Me Goo, took up the chase by coming from fifth and going without cover.

Nelsonbriteagle continued her sharp speed around the last turn, but Zeron thought he had a chance at overtaking her and pulled pocket before the 1:22 2/5 three-quarters had been reached. It didn't take long for Zeron to get back to the pylons, though, as Nelsonbriteagle hit another gear and sprinted away with a 27 2/5 final quarter to complete the mile. Allegiant was a solid second as the other sophomore filly in the race, with Warrawee Xenia coming on late for third.

For Dunn, it was the third consecutive win in this race, having previously guided the Svanstedt-trained Jiggy Jog S.

"She felt good behind the gate tonight," said Dunn. "It was a great effort by her."

As a 9-5 offering Nelsonbriteagle NO returned $5.60 to win. Owned by Ake Svanstedt Inc., and breeder Nils Johan Munkhaugen, Nelsonbriteagle won for the third time in nine starts this season.
